如何从网站检索数据到iPhone应用程序

时间:2010-11-28 05:17:06

标签: iphone objective-c cocoa-touch iphone-sdk-4.0.1

我正在制作iphone应用程序。

我是个新手。

我想从我的网站上获取数据。我该怎么做才能实现这个目标?

需要做什么?

请帮帮我

由于

任何教程都会有很大的帮助。

5 个答案:

答案 0 :(得分:1)

如果您的问题是从网站获取数据到iphone,那么您只需使用JSON解析来获取数据。

您必须从您的网站将所有数据作为JSON字符串传递到iPhone中。然后将收到的数据解析到iPhone中。

您可以在此处参考此链接

http://www.raywenderlich.com/5492/working-with-json-in-ios-5

希望这有助于你

答案 1 :(得分:0)

对于服务器端,我建议使用Web服务将数据发送到您的客户端。

原作者修订:

Linux Journal的9月号发表了一篇关于使用免费工具和框架编写适用于Android和iPhone / iPad的移动应用程序的优秀文章。以下是在线文章的链接:

Developing Portable Mobile Web Applications

答案 2 :(得分:0)

将您的数据从您的网站公开为WebService,XML,JSON等。使用iPhone应用程序消费。 您的网站使用的是哪种语言?取决于可以提供哪些样本。

James Kennard的第10章,掌握Joomla! 1.5:API和Webservices包含8页有关XML-RPC的内容。

对于真实的例子,搜索Joomla!扩展目录。 http://extensions.joomla.org/extensions/search/xml-rpc

这是另一个启动http://www.slideshare.net/coolparth/rest-api-for-joomla

的人

答案 3 :(得分:0)

你将使用NSURLConnection,NSURLRequest和NSURL类这里是Apple的一个例子; http://developer.apple.com/library/mac/ipad/#documentation/Cocoa/Conceptual/URLLoadingSystem/Tasks/UsingNSURLConnection.html

答案 4 :(得分:0)

以前的答案建议使用NSURLConnection,但我发现它自己使用起来有点麻烦。我建议使用包装NSURLConnection(或CFNetwork)的东西。一些示例:ASIHTTPRequest(基于CFNetwork),httpriotSeriously(NSURLConnection /基于块)。